The County Peace Officers operate under the authority of the Alberta Solicitor General to enforce the Traffic Safety Act, Gaming and Liquor Act, Animal Protection Act, Environmental Protection Act, Highway Development and Protection Act, Petty Trespass Act, Provincial Offences Procedures Act and County Bylaws.
The Peace Officers are committed to serving the residents of Camrose County by providing effective law enforcement and community based policing. They are committed to protecting Camrose County's interests including road infrastructure, parks, campgrounds, and liability concerns. County Peace Officers are also under contract to patrol the Villages of Edberg, Bawlf, Bittern Lake, Hay Lakes and the Town of Bashaw.
